Rep. Friess files bill to allocate $5 million for Stringtown Levee repairs

State Representative David Friess has introduced HB4146, a bill proposing the allocation of $5 million from the Build Illinois Bond Fund to the Department of Commerce and Economic Opportunity. The funds are intended for Monroe County to support construction, improvements, and repairs to the Stringtown Levee.

The Stringtown Levee has been identified as essential for protecting homes, farmland, and infrastructure in the region. Representative Friess stated, “This is not just about infrastructure, it’s about protecting lives and livelihoods. The Stringtown Levee has been a vital line of defense for our communities for decades, and it’s high time the state steps up to ensure it continues doing so safely and effectively.”

Friess has been working with local officials, the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, and state agencies to address the levee’s deteriorating condition. While federal funding efforts have slowed, HB4146 is described as a significant state-level measure to secure the necessary resources.

“Our residents in the bottom have waited long enough,” Friess said. “We’ve seen promises made and deadlines missed, but this bill puts real dollars on the table. We cannot afford more delays; the time to act is now.”

Friess encourages community members to contact their state legislators in support of HB4146, emphasizing the importance of advocacy and bipartisan cooperation for passing the bill. If enacted, the legislation would take effect on July 1, 2026, enabling Monroe County to begin construction and repairs.

David Friess, a Republican, was elected in 2023 to represent Illinois’ 115th House District, succeeding Nathan Reitz.
